Required Meta Tags per Page
<!-- In BaseLayout.astro <head> -->
<meta name="description" content={description} />
<meta name="author" content="David E. Sánchez Román" />
<!-- Open Graph -->
<meta property="og:title" content={title} />
<meta property="og:description" content={description} />
<meta property="og:type" content="website" />
<meta property="og:url" content={Astro.url} />
<meta property="og:image" content="/og-image.jpg" />
<meta property="og:locale" content="es_CL" />
<!-- Twitter Card -->
<meta name="twitter:card" content="summary_large_image" />
<meta name="twitter:title" content={title} />
<meta name="twitter:description" content={description} />
<meta name="twitter:image" content="/og-image.jpg" />Page-Specific Descriptions

Sitemap & Robots
Install @astrojs/sitemap:
npx astro add sitemapCreate public/robots.txt:
User-agent: *
Allow: /
Sitemap: https://YOUR-DOMAIN.netlify.app/sitemap-index.xmlRules
1. Every page needs a unique <title> and <meta description> 2. One <h1> per page — no exceptions 3. All images need alt attributes 4. Use semantic HTML (<section>, <nav>, <main>, <footer>) 5. Internal links use descriptive text (not "click here")
